Romania has emerged as one of Central and Eastern Europe's most dynamic digital transformation markets. With a GDP growth rate consistently outpacing the EU average and a rapidly expanding middle class, Romanian businesses are aggressively adopting self-service technologies to improve operational efficiency and customer experience.
Major Romanian cities including Bucharest, Cluj-Napoca, Timișoara, Iași, and Brașov are witnessing a significant surge in self-service kiosk deployments across fast food chains, shopping malls, government offices, hospitals, and transport hubs. The country's EU membership has accelerated the adoption of international retail and hospitality standards, making self-service kiosk machines an essential investment for competitive businesses.
Romanian consumers, particularly the tech-savvy millennial and Gen-Z demographic, show strong preference for contactless, fast, and intuitive self-service experiences — a trend that has been further accelerated by the post-pandemic shift in consumer behavior. Understanding the key drivers shaping the self-service kiosk industry across Romania and the broader Eastern European market.
Romanian businesses are increasingly integrating AI-driven voice recognition and facial recognition into kiosk systems, enabling personalized, multilingual customer experiences in both Romanian and English. AI-powered upselling and recommendation engines are boosting average transaction values in QSR and retail environments.
With Romania's rapidly growing cashless payment adoption and the dominance of Visa/Mastercard contactless and mobile wallets like Apple Pay and Google Pay, modern kiosks now feature integrated NFC payment terminals — a critical requirement for the Romanian market's payment ecosystem.
Multi-location Romanian businesses such as supermarket chains, pharmacy networks (Catena, Sensiblu), and fast food franchises (McDonald's, KFC Romania) are leveraging cloud-based content management systems to remotely update menus, pricing, and promotions across hundreds of kiosk units simultaneously.

Romanian municipalities including Bucharest, Cluj-Napoca, and Timișoara are investing in smart city infrastructure, deploying outdoor interactive kiosks for public information, transport ticketing, tourism guidance, and e-government services — creating significant market opportunities.

Major Romanian and international fast food chains across Bucharest, Cluj, and Timișoara deploy self-ordering kiosks to reduce queue times, increase average order value, and free staff for food preparation and customer service.
AFI Palace, Sun Plaza, Băneasa Shopping City, and other major Romanian malls use interactive kiosks for wayfinding, product catalog browsing, loyalty program management, and promotional campaigns.
Romanian hospitals and private medical clinics (Regina Maria, Medicover) are implementing check-in kiosks to streamline patient registration, appointment scheduling, and queue management — reducing administrative workload significantly.
Bucharest Henri Coandă International Airport, CFR Călători railway stations, and major bus terminals are deploying self-service ticketing and information kiosks to handle growing passenger volumes efficiently.
Romanian banks including Banca Transilvania, BRD, and ING Romania are expanding self-service banking zones with interactive kiosks for account inquiries, document submission, and financial product information.
Romanian public institutions are deploying e-government kiosks for citizen services including document applications, utility payments, permit submissions, and public information access — reducing bureaucratic queues.
Romanian universities and schools are using self-service kiosks for student enrollment, library management, campus wayfinding, and administrative service delivery — improving campus efficiency.
Major Romanian fuel station networks (OMV Petrom, Rompetrol) are integrating self-service payment and ordering kiosks at convenience stores, enabling faster customer throughput during peak hours.
